Objective:To study the chemical constituents of ethyl acetate-soluble parts in the 70% aqueous ethanolic extract of the stems and leaf of Callicarpa kwangtungensis Chun.Methods:The chemical constituents were isolated and purified by chromatographic column on silica gel,ODS,Sephadex LH-20 and MPLC.Their structures were elucidated by thin layer chromatographic analysis,spectroscopic evidence and compared with those in literatures.Results:Eight compounds were isolated from ethyl acetate soluble part of the 70% aqueous ethanolic extract,whose structures were elucidated as linderagalactone D(1),syringic acid (2),loliolide (3),schizonepetin (4) 4-hydroxybenzoic acid (5),4-hydroxybenzaldehyde (6),chlojaponilactone A (7),1R,8-dihydroxymenthol (8).Conclusion:Compounds 1、3-8 were isolated from this plant for the first time.%目的:研究广东紫珠Callicarpa kwangtungensis Chun茎和叶的70%乙醇水提取物的乙酸乙酯萃取部位的化学成分.方法:利用硅胶、ODS、Sephadex LH-20、MPLC等柱色谱方法进行化合物的分离纯化,根据化合物的薄层色谱和波谱分析方法及文献资料查询来进行结构鉴定.结果:从广东紫珠乙酸乙酯溶性部位分离得到8个化合物,分别为:乌药倍半萜内酯D(1),丁香酸(2),黑麦草内酯(3),荆芥内酯(4),4-羟基苯甲酸(5),4-羟基苯甲醛(6),日本金粟兰内酯A(7),1R,8-二羟基薄荷醇(8).结论:化合物1、3~8为首次从该植物中分离得到.
